Leveraging Partnerships for Market Expansion

Expanding into new markets often presents significant hurdles, including unfamiliar regulations, cultural nuances, and competitive pressures. Strategic partnerships can serve as a powerful catalyst for overcoming these obstacles, providing access to established networks, local expertise, and valuable market insights. A partner already operating within the target market can assist with navigating the legal and logistical complexities, accelerating the entry process and minimizing potential risks. They can also provide invaluable support in adapting products and services to meet local preferences, ensuring optimal market acceptance. Furthermore, co-branding opportunities and joint marketing initiatives can significantly enhance brand recognition and reach a wider audience.

Building Trust and Rapport with Potential Partners

The foundation of any successful partnership lies in trust and mutual respect. Before initiating collaboration, it's crucial to carefully vet potential partners, assessing their values, capabilities, and strategic alignment. Thorough due diligence, open communication, and a clear understanding of each party’s expectations are essential. Establishing a well-defined partnership agreement outlining roles, responsibilities, and revenue-sharing arrangements helps avoid misunderstandings and ensures a fair and equitable relationship. Regularly scheduled check-ins and open channels of communication foster transparency and facilitate proactive problem-solving. Remember that a successful partnership is a long-term commitment that requires continuous nurturing and investment.

Partnership Type Key Benefits Potential Challenges
Joint Venture Shared resources, risk mitigation, market access Potential conflicts of interest, decision-making complexity
Strategic Alliance Access to expertise, expanded reach, innovation Communication barriers, differing priorities
Franchising Rapid expansion, brand recognition, local market knowledge Loss of control, quality concerns
Licensing Revenue generation, reduced investment, market penetration Intellectual property protection, brand dilution

Thinking strategically about the right type of partnership is crucial. Factors like control, financial investment, and desired level of integration all play a role in determining the optimal structure for achieving business goals. Selecting a partner whose values and strategic objectives align with your own dramatically increases the probability of long-term success.

Navigating the Legal and Contractual Aspects of Partnerships

Establishing a legally sound partnership agreement is paramount to protecting the interests of all parties involved. This agreement should clearly define the scope of the partnership, the roles and responsibilities of each partner, the financial contributions and revenue-sharing arrangements, and the dispute resolution mechanisms. It’s crucial to address intellectual property rights, confidentiality obligations, and termination clauses. Engaging legal counsel with expertise in partnership law is highly recommended to ensure that the agreement is comprehensive, enforceable, and compliant with applicable regulations. Failing to adequately address legal and contractual considerations can lead to disputes, financial losses, and irreparable damage to business relationships.

Key Clauses to Include in a Partnership Agreement

A robust partnership agreement should include several key clauses to mitigate risks and ensure a smooth working relationship. These include a clear definition of the partnership’s purpose, a detailed description of each partner’s contributions, a comprehensive intellectual property ownership clause, a dispute resolution process (such as mediation or arbitration), and a termination clause outlining the conditions under which the partnership can be dissolved. Additionally, it’s essential to address liability issues, indemnification provisions, and governing law. Regular review and updates to the agreement are necessary to reflect changing business circumstances and legal requirements. This proactive approach safeguards against potential conflicts and reinforces the long-term viability of the partnership.
